Course Details

Youth Development Theory: Understanding the theoretical frameworks and principles that underpin effective youth development.
Positive Youth Development: Emphasizing strengths, resilience, and assets to promote healthy youth development.
Cultural Competence in Youth Work: Developing cultural awareness, knowledge, and skills to work effectively with diverse youth populations.
Youth Program Planning and Evaluation: Designing, implementing, and evaluating high-quality youth programs using evidence-based practices.
Mental Health and Well-being in Youth: Identifying and addressing mental health challenges and promoting well-being in youth.
Youth Leadership and Empowerment: Fostering youth leadership, empowerment, and participation in decision-making processes.
Community Engagement and Collaboration: Building partnerships and collaborations with community stakeholders to support youth development.
Policy and Advocacy for Thriving Youth: Understanding and advocating for policies that support positive youth development at the local, state, and national levels.
